【虚拟化技术详解】
虚拟化是一种信息技术,它允许在单个物理硬件系统上创建和运行多个独立的虚拟环境,每个环境都可以运行不同的操作系统和应用程序。虚拟化的核心在于它能够高效地利用硬件资源,提高服务器利用率,同时提供隔离、灵活性和可扩展性。
【SecurAble工具解析】
SecurAble是一款小巧而实用的工具,由Gigabyte(技嘉)公司开发,用于检测计算机的处理器是否具备硬件级别的虚拟化支持。这个特性对于运行某些特定的应用,如Windows 7中的XP Mode,或者使用虚拟机软件(如VMware、VirtualBox等)至关重要。SecurAble通过读取CPU的ID来识别其是否包含Intel VT或AMD-V这样的虚拟化技术。
【硬件虚拟化技术】
1. Intel VT(Intel Virtualization Technology):这是Intel为处理器引入的一项技术,它扩展了x86架构,以支持在单个处理器上同时运行多个操作系统实例。Intel VT提供了硬件辅助的虚拟化,显著提高了虚拟机的性能和效率。
2. AMD-V(AMD Virtualization):AMD公司的对应技术,同样提供硬件级别的虚拟化支持。AMD-V利用了名为“嵌套页表”的技术,可以减少软件模拟虚拟化层的需求,从而提高性能。
【Windows 7的XP Mode】
XP Mode是Windows 7操作系统的一个特色功能,允许用户在Windows 7环境中运行基于Windows XP的应用程序。这是因为许多老版软件与Windows 7不兼容。通过内置的虚拟机(基于Microsoft Virtual PC),用户可以无缝地在Windows 7界面下打开和操作Windows XP的窗口,无需重新启动电脑或进行复杂的配置。
【虚拟机软件】
除了Windows 7的XP Mode,市面上还有多种虚拟机软件可供选择,例如:
1. VMware Workstation:专业级的虚拟机软件,适用于企业和个人用户,支持多种操作系统,并提供高级的虚拟化功能。
2. VirtualBox:开源的虚拟机软件,免费供个人和商业使用,支持多种操作系统,功能丰富,易于使用。
3. Hyper-V:微软的虚拟化平台,集成在Windows Server和部分版本的Windows 10中,提供高性能的虚拟化解决方案。
【总结】
SecurAble是检查硬件虚拟化支持的重要工具,对于想要利用虚拟化技术的用户,尤其是需要运行Windows 7的XP Mode或其他虚拟机应用的用户来说,这款软件非常有用。理解并掌握虚拟化技术,不仅可以提升工作效率,还能为系统管理和维护带来诸多便利。